A leading roadside assistance provider in the UK seeks a skilled Roadside Technician to deliver expert mechanical repairs and diagnostics. The role offers a base salary of £35,000 with OTE of £60,000, alongside generous benefits including a share scheme, breakdown cover, and wellbeing support.
Applicants should have:
- A Level 2 maintenance qualification
- A full UK driving licence
- A proven technical background
